Corylopsis pauciflora

Family Hamamelidaceae
Plant Type deciduous shrub
Zone USDA:   6a - 8b   RHS:   H   EGF:   H2 - H4   Australia:   1 - 2  
Care Level low, easy, suitable for beginners.
Height 1.2 - 1.8 m (4 - 6 ft)
Spread 1.2 - 1.8 m (4 - 6 ft)
Light full sun to partial shade
Soil Moisture average to moist, well-drained
Soil Type loam
Soil pH acidic

Description Corylopsis pauciflora (buttercup winter hazel) bears showy, pastel yellow and fragrant blossoms during early spring to mid-spring. This deciduous shrub is spreading in form and has edged greyish green and dark magenta foliage. Find a prominent place in your garden for this stunning deciduous shrub which has been designated a specimen.
Typical Uses Border, mass planting, specimen and woodland.
